Can You Use Cedar Bedding For Guinea Pigs. Apart from its unpleasant smell, cedar contains oils that can cause respiratory problems in guinea pigs. Cedar is not safe for guinea pigs. No, do not use cedar bedding for guinea pigs. Can i use cedar or pine shavings as bedding for my guinea pig?
